Output 23276230c342f25830903155adcc795263ad09c74e5dcc3352954f32236241aa:0

value
318286457
script pubkey
OP_0 OP_PUSHBYTES_20 75366392a6d5324812719383204abb9a7e97f33e
address
bc1qw5mx8y4x65eysyn3jwpjqj4mnflf0ue765ga7j
transaction
23276230c342f25830903155adcc795263ad09c74e5dcc3352954f32236241aa
spent
true